The first two people to go would be the runners without any raw speed. Then, I would say the 400/800 guys would run out of steam and go next. After that, it gets pretty difficult. This race would test strength more than anything, because the uneven pacing and strong start will make runners who normally keep a strong rhythm suffer. I think some 1500 runners could last awhile because of their strength, but some 5k runners may suffer. Here's what I have:
